contract1
Class Opportunity

Attributes
Primitive Type short closeProbability closeProbability
Primitive Type dateTime estimatedCloseDate estimatedCloseDate
Primitive Type decimal estimatedValue estimatedValue
Primitive Type string nextStep nextStep
Class code opportunityRating opportunityRating
Class code opportunitySource opportunitySource

Operations
Class OpportunityCreateQuoteResult createQuote createQuote
Class Void markAsClosed markAsClosed

Properties:

Alias
Classifier Behavior
Collections
Is Abstractfalse
Is Activefalse
Is Leaffalse
Keywords
NameOpportunity
Name Expression
Owned Template Signature
OwnerPackage contract1
Owning Parameter
PackagePackage contract1
Packageable Element visibilitypublic
Qualified Namecontract1::contract1::Opportunity
Representation
Stereotype
Template Parameter
Visibilitypublic

Attribute Details

 closeProbability
public Primitive Type short closeProbability
Properties:

Aggregationnone
Alias
Association
Association End
Class Class Opportunity
Collections
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ower0
Lower ValueLiteral Integer
Multiplicity0..1
NamecloseProbability
Name Expression
Opposite
Owned Template Signature
OwnerClass Opportunity
Owning Association
Owning Parameter
Qualified Namecontract1::contract1::Opportunity::closeProbability
Stereotype
Template Parameter
TypePrimitive Type short
Upper1
Upper ValueLiteral Unlimited Natural
Visibilitypublic


 estimatedCloseDate
public Primitive Type dateTime estimatedCloseDate
Properties:

Aggregationnone
Alias
Association
Association End
Class Class Opportunity
Collections
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ower0
Lower ValueLiteral Integer
Multiplicity0..1
NameestimatedCloseDate
Name Expression
Opposite
Owned Template Signature
OwnerClass Opportunity
Owning Association
Owning Parameter
Qualified Namecontract1::contract1::Opportunity::estimatedCloseDate
Stereotype
Template Parameter
TypePrimitive Type dateTime
Upper1
Upper ValueLiteral Unlimited Natural
Visibilitypublic


 estimatedValue
public Primitive Type decimal estimatedValue
Properties:

Aggregationnone
Alias
Association
Association End
Class Class Opportunity
Collections
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ower0
Lower ValueLiteral Integer
Multiplicity0..1
NameestimatedValue
Name Expression
Opposite
Owned Template Signature
OwnerClass Opportunity
Owning Association
Owning Parameter
Qualified Namecontract1::contract1::Opportunity::estimatedValue
Stereotype
Template Parameter
TypePrimitive Type decimal
Upper1
Upper ValueLiteral Unlimited Natural
Visibilitypublic


 nextStep
public Primitive Type string nextStep
Properties:

Aggregationnone
Alias
Association
Association End
Class Class Opportunity
Collections
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ower0
Lower ValueLiteral Integer
Multiplicity0..1
NamenextStep
Name Expression
Opposite
Owned Template Signature
OwnerClass Opportunity
Owning Association
Owning Parameter
Qualified Namecontract1::contract1::Opportunity::nextStep
Stereotype
Template Parameter
TypePrimitive Type string
Upper1
Upper ValueLiteral Unlimited Natural
Visibilitypublic


 opportunityRating
public Class code opportunityRating
Properties:

Aggregationnone
Alias
Association
Association End
Class Class Opportunity
Collections
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ower1
Lower Value
Multiplicity1
NameopportunityRating
Name Expression
Opposite
Owned Template Signature
OwnerClass Opportunity
Owning Association
Owning Parameter
Qualified Namecontract1::contract1::Opportunity::opportunityRating
Stereotype
Template Parameter
TypeClass code
Upper1
Upper Value
Visibilitypublic


 opportunitySource
public Class code opportunitySource
Properties:

Aggregationnone
Alias
Association
Association End
Class Class Opportunity
Collections
Datatype
Default
Default Value
Is Compositefalse
Is Derivedfalse
Is Derived Unionfalse
Is Leaffalse
Is Orderedfalse
Is Read Onlyf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ower1
Lower Value
Multiplicity1
NameopportunitySource
Name Expression
Opposite
Owned Template Signature
OwnerClass Opportunity
Owning Association
Owning Parameter
Qualified Namecontract1::contract1::Opportunity::opportunitySource
Stereotype
Template Parameter
TypeClass code
Upper1
Upper Value
Visibilitypublic

Operation Details

 createQuote
public Class OpportunityCreateQuoteResult createQuote( Class Void  )
Parameters:
Class Void in
Returns:
Class OpportunityCreateQuoteResult
Properties:

Alias
Body Condition
Class Class Opportunity
Collections
Concurrencysequential
Datatype
Is Abstractfalse
Is Leaffalse
Is Orderedfalse
Is Queryf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ower1
Lower Value
Multiplicity1
NamecreateQuote
Name Expression
Owned Template Signature
OwnerClass Opportunity
Owning Parameter
Qualified Namecontract1::contract1::Opportunity::createQuote
Stereotype
Template Parameter
TypeClass OpportunityCreateQuoteResult
Upper1
Upper Value
Visibilitypublic


 markAsClosed
public Class Void markAsClosed( Class OpportunityMarkAsClosedParams  )
Parameters:
Class OpportunityMarkAsClosedParams in
Returns:
Class Void
Properties:

Alias
Body Condition
Class Class Opportunity
Collections
Concurrencysequential
Datatype
Is Abstractfalse
Is Leaffalse
Is Orderedfalse
Is Queryfalse
Is Staticfalse
Is Uniquetrue
Keywords
Lower1
Lower Value
Multiplicity1
NamemarkAsClosed
Name Expression
Owned Template Signature
OwnerClass Opportunity
Owning Parameter
Qualified Namecontract1::contract1::Opportunity::markAsClosed
Stereotype
Template Parameter
TypeClass Void
Upper1
Upper Value
Visibilitypublic